摘要
The oxidative addition of H2 to the mixed ligand Rh(I) complex [RhCl(PPh3)(diphos)] 1 and the Rh(I) and Ir(I) complexes of the terdentate ligands NP3, [N(CH2CH2PPh2)3] and triphos, [PhP(CH2CH2PPh2)2], MLCl 2-5 (where M = Rh(I), Ir(I); L = NP3, triphos) proceeds at 30°C and 1 atm of H2 in ethanol-benzene. The homogeneous hydrogenation of cyclohexene catalyzed by complexes 1-5 was investigated in the temperature range 10-40°C at 0.6-1 atm of H2 partial pressure. Thermodynamic parameters for the formation of the dihydrido complexes of 1-5 and the monoolefin complexes of Rh(I) and Ir(I) were computed. The activation parameters corresponding to the rate constant k for the homogeneous hydrogenation of cyclohexene were also calculated.
